PacifiCare Replaces Chief Medical Officer

NU Online News Service, May 24, 1:18 p.m. – PacifiCare Health Systems Inc., Santa Ana, Calif., has promoted Dr. Sam Ho to the positions of senior vice president and chief medical officer.

The company has also promoted Pete McKinley to vice president of network management.

Ho, who succeeds Dr. Michael Kaufman, will report to Brad Bowlus, president of the company’s health plans division.

Ho joined PacifiCare of California in 1994 and worked heavily on quality improvement programs. Before joining PacifiCare, he worked for Health Net Inc., Woodland Hills, Calif., and served as a deputy director at the San Francisco Department of Public Health.

He has also been chairman of the California Medical Association and California Nurses’ Association’s Joint Practice Commission.

Ho has a bachelor’s degree from Northwestern University and a medical degree from Tufts University.

McKinley, the new vice president of network management, previously was president of PacifiCare of California’s Northern California operations.

McKinley has been the chief operating officer for ReadyScript Inc., Newport Beach, Calif., a wireless health care communications startup; president of IntensiCare Corp., San Diego, a company that manages in-patient hospital care for managed care companies; and vice president of business development for Talbert Medical Management Corp., Costa Mesa, Calif., a physician practice management company.

McKinley has a bachelor’s degree in business administration from the University of Southern California and a master’s degree in business administration from Pepperdine University.
